Hostels let you really see Fremont
A hostel is your ticket to a great trip in Fremont. Some include private rooms, while others offer double beds or bunk beds, so your whole crew can split the cost. If you’re traveling alone, hostels are the perfect way to find your Fremont family and maybe even pick up a trail buddy.  

Youth hostels in Fremont are the best way to see the sights without losing your savings. Perks can include free Wi-Fi, free breakfast, and options for private rooms and bathrooms. Some hostels also include common areas where you can cook and share meals together, reheat leftovers, or just gather around to swap stories.
